EW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

720 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Edwards Lifesciences (EW)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$20.8B — up 25% from $16.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 87 funds opened new EW positions and 52 closed out — a net gain of 35 holders — while 227 added to existing stakes and 287 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of New York Mellon, adding an estimated $359M. The largest seller was Ameriprise, cutting an estimated $151M.
